Description
You can’t buy it. You can’t borrow it. You can’t even steal it. Immensely valuable and desired, yet difficult to acquire, the journey to wisdom has few shortcuts. There are, however, few endeavors more fulfilling. While no one can teach you how to be wise, this carefully researched book by Jason Merchey, author of The Values of the Wise Book Series, may help you grow to love the pursuit of it. In fact, “philosophy” is Greek for “the love of wisdom.” Synthesizing art and science, intellect and emotion, spirituality and Humanism, Merchey provides a compass to help readers navigate toward more personal growth, happiness, and fulfillment in life. A deeply compelling combination of unique and challenging quotations and personal reflections, Merchey’s insights reveal just how life-changing the pursuit of wisdom can be when we learn how to prioritize it.
